    Ensuite, en utilisant le certificat, le client et le Proxy de terminaison TLS **décident comment chiffrer** le reste de la **communication TCP**. Cela termine la partie **négociation TLS**.
    
    Après cela, le client et le serveur disposent d'une **connexion TCP chiffrée**, c'est ce que fournit TLS. Ils peuvent alors utiliser cette connexion pour démarrer la **communication HTTP** proprement dite.
